Human Resources announces a 1.0 FTE vacancy, grade A-09, 187 days, located at Alice West Fleet Elementary School.
Provide support to teacher and to students in general education and special education classrooms. Ability to communicate with parents. Collaborative team player. Willingness to work under teacher direction and supervision. Ability to work effectively with staff, parents, and children.
Experience working with students with special needs. Experience working in a classroom setting.
Based on 26/27 Pay Plan. Newly hired individuals with previous experience in their field may receive salary credit for up to 5 years of experience related to the job being filled.

Candidates must have a high school diploma and an associate degree or at least 60 semester hours of college study. Applicants must also meet NCLB and ESEA requirements or pass the Parapro Test.
